基于FPGA的LTE空间复用预编码的实现

Implementation of LTE spatial multiplexing based on FPGA

摘要 通过分析基于现场可编辑门阵列(FPGA)的长期演进(LTE)物理层中空间复用预编码实现的问题,提出了一种基于码本的预编码实现算法。根据上层告知的属性参数在预先建立的系数表和加减关系表中查表,对层映射后的数据先进行系数乘法运算,再进行加减运算,从而代替了复数矩阵乘法运算。因此可以大大减少预编码环节中的复数矩阵乘法次数,并降低了编码处理的复杂度,提高了编码运算的速度。仿真实验结果表明,所提算法能够很好地实现系统功能。 Through the analysis of Field-Programmable Gate Array(FPGA)-based spatial multiplexing coding problem in Long Term Evolution(LTE),an implementation of codebook-based precoding was proposed.According to the parameters of the upper informed carried on the table look-up in the mathematical table and the addition and subtraction relations table,the data of layer mapping first carried on coefficient multiplication,and then with addition and subtraction,thus this has replaced the complex matrix multiplication operation.Therefore,this method can greatly reduce the complex matrix multiplication operation in the precoding procedure,and reduce the complexity of encoding process,improve the speed of the encoding operation.The experimental results indicate that the proposed algorithm can achieve a good system performance.
出处 《计算机应用》 CSCD 北大核心 2012年第6期1503-1505,1512,共4页 journal of Computer Applications
关键词 长期演进 空间复用 预编码 现场可编辑门阵列 Long Term Evolution(LTE) spatial multiplexing precoding Field-Programmable Gate Array(FPGA)
